Pineapple Banana Bread

Pineapple Banana Bread
adapted from playing with sugar

1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1 cup sugar
1/2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p baking soda
1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
1 egg
1 egg white
1/2 cup applesauce
1 tsp vanilla extract
4oz crushed pineapple, drained juice reserved
2 Tbsp pineapple juice
1 cups (2 to 3 medium) mashed ripe bananas

In a large bowl, combine the flour, sugar, salt, baking soda, and cinnamon. In another bowl, beat the eggs, applesauce and vanilla; add pineapple, pineapple juice and bananas. Stir into the dry ingredients just until moistened. Pour into a greased 8-in. x 4-in. loaf pan.

Bake at 350 for 60-65 minutes or until golden brown and a toothpick remains clean when inserted into the center. If the tops are start to get too brown, cover with a piece of foil and continue baking to prevent top from getting too dark.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ks.

Yield: 1 loaf.
